Portiuncula Hospital to hold special mass to celebrate 80 years of service

Galway Bay fm newsroom – Portiuncula Hospital in Ballinasloe is to hold a special mass toomorrow, Thursday April 20) to celebrate 80 years of service.

The Franciscan Missionaries of the Divine Motherhood opened a nursing home at “Mount Pleasant” in 1943 – and a hospital was later opened in 1945.

The hospital is named after the small church of Portiuncula in Italy, the place where Franciscanism began.

The mass will take place at Gullanes Hotel at 3 tomorrow afternoon
